Sexual experimentation is an integral part of human life and can be seen as a way to learn about oneself and others. It functions as a mechanism for developing relational and social skills through exploration and interaction. Sexual experimentation allows individuals to explore their own bodies and preferences while also learning about how to interact with others in a safe and healthy manner. Through this process, people are able to develop communication skills, intimacy, trust, and mutual understanding.
When engaging in consensual sexual activity, partners must communicate with each other to negotiate boundaries, desires, and needs. This requires active listening, clear expression, and understanding of nonverbal cues.
It fosters intimacy and trust between partners, as they share vulnerable moments together.
Experimenting with different positions, acts, and emotions can help individuals better understand their own bodies and desires, leading to more self-awareness and confidence.
Sexual experimentation provides opportunities to build social connections and networks.
Meeting new people and participating in activities like swinger parties or BDSM clubs can introduce individuals to new perspectives and experiences that may otherwise remain hidden. These interactions can lead to forming relationships based on shared interests and experiences, expanding one's social circle and broadening horizons.
There are potential risks associated with sexual experimentation. Without proper education, communication, and safety precautions, sexual experimentation can lead to physical and emotional harm. Therefore, it is essential to approach sexual exploration responsibly and with consideration for oneself and others involved. It is crucial to ensure consent, use protection, and be mindful of potential consequences before engaging in any act.
Sexual experimentation functions as an important mechanism for learning relational and social skills through exploration, communication, intimacy, and building connections. While there are risks involved, it has the potential to enrich lives by fostering personal growth, deepening relationships, and creating meaningful experiences.
